One sure way to feel like a foreigner is to explore establishments where English is not an option. On Saturday, Amir and I met up in Chinatown and walked along Canal and all its side streets. I usually pass through this area, occasionally picking up a few things from the market, but I’ve never taken a moment to really explore.  This may or may not have do with the fact that years ago, before I lived in New York, I was naively lured below Canal St. and into an underground factory of sorts for $5 DVDs. A rookie mistake.
The rain was a bummer, but it literally pushed us to explore some of the shops that we might have passed by otherwise including an Asian grocery, a fancy Dim Sum restaurant, a traditional tea shop and many fresh fish and produce markets with so many exotic fruits I’ve never even seen before.
It wasn’t the best day to have my camera out, but I did manage to get a few photos like this one of a serious game of I-have-no-clue. It had to be somewhat of a big deal in the community because more than a dozen people gathered around to watch.
